We are the Presto company. Starburst engineering team is the major contributor to Presto, a dominant open source distributed SQL query engine. Presto was originally created and open-sourced by Facebook under the Apache 2 License. Today Presto is the fastest growing SQL engine driven by a broad community of users ranging from Fortune 500 companies to small nonprofits. Our team consists of experts who have been advancing Presto by committing to it since the very start of the project.

Starburst gives analysts the freedom to work with diverse data sets wherever the data lives, without compromising on performance. Using the open source Presto SQL engine, the Starburst Distribution of Presto provides fast, interactive query performance across a wide variety of data sources including HDFS, Amazon S3, MySQL, SQL Server, PostgreSQL, Cassandra, MongoDB, Kafka, and Teradata, among others. Founded by the largest team of Presto committers outside of Facebook, Starburst is the only company providing enterprise support for the Presto project.
